ABOUT THIS Episode

As millennials and first-generation immigrants from the Philippines, our experiences and perspectives on money have unique similarities and differences. 

If you've seen or listened to our episodes on season 1, you'll know our stories as children who were left behind by our parents while they work abroad to support us. How did that influence our outlook on money and on life in general?

The All Abroad Podcast gals get a little serious about money because we want to inspire other people to get savvy with their financial situations. Most Filipinos get a little squirmy when talking about money but we have to change that. We have to be more open to discussing the best ways we should invest our money. 

"You're comfortable talking about your money if you're confident with your money."  ~ Sweeney

We want to see everyone win and we hope that this conversation and the ideas we've shared have inspired you.
